Stalowa Wola is a railway station in Stalowa Wola, Subcarpathian Voivodeship, Poland.
Until recently, Twoje Linie Kolejowe trains stopped here, today only Regio trains.
At the station, there is a closed station building, built in the early 1950s, in poor condition, with ticket offices open until 2012.
[1] In 2017, the station served 100–149 passengers a day.
